这里是文章模块栏目内容页
出现两个mysql服务(有两个mysql)

导读:本文将介绍如何在同一台服务器上安装和配置两个MySQL服务。这种情况可能会出现在需要同时运行不同版本的MySQL或者为了隔离数据而使用多个实例的情况下。通过本文的步骤,您可以轻松地创建和管理多个MySQL服务。

1. 安装第一个MySQL服务

首先,我们需要安装第一个MySQL服务。在Ubuntu系统中,可以使用以下命令进行安装:

sudo apt-get install mysql-server

安装完成后,您可以使用以下命令启动MySQL服务:

sudo systemctl start mysql

2. 配置第一个MySQL服务

在默认情况下,MySQL服务将监听3306端口。如果您想更改此端口号,可以编辑/etc/mysql/mysql.conf.d/mysqld.cnf文件,并将port参数设置为所需的端口号。

您还可以更改MySQL服务的其他配置,例如数据目录、日志文件等。

3. 安装第二个MySQL服务

要安装第二个MySQL服务,您需要下载另一个版本的MySQL,并将其解压缩到另一个目录中。然后,您可以使用以下命令启动第二个MySQL服务:

/path/to/second/mysql/bin/mysqld_safe --defaults-file=/path/to/second/mysql/my.cnf &

4. 配置第二个MySQL服务

与第一个MySQL服务类似,您可以编辑第二个MySQL服务的配置文件(my.cnf)来更改其配置。请确保第二个MySQL服务使用不同的端口号,并将数据目录和日志文件等设置为不同的目录。

5. 总结

通过本文介绍的步骤,您可以在同一台服务器上创建和管理多个MySQL服务。这种情况可能会出现在需要同时运行不同版本的MySQL或者为了隔离数据而使用多个实例的情况下。请注意,每个MySQL服务都应该使用不同的端口号和配置文件,以避免冲突。

标签:MySQL、多实例、配置文件、端口号、数据目录